
要制作网页数据分析表格,首先需要明确分析目标、选择合适的数据分析工具、收集并整理数据、设计表格结构、应用数据可视化技术。这几个步骤是关键。选择合适的数据分析工具是整个过程的核心步骤之一。选择工具时需考虑数据量、分析的复杂度和团队的技术水平。工具的选择会直接影响数据分析的效率和结果的准确性。FineBI是一款优秀的数据分析工具,它不仅功能强大,而且操作简便,适合不同技术水平的用户。FineBI官网: https://s.fanruan.com/f459r;。接下来,我将详细介绍每个步骤。
一、明确分析目标
在进行任何数据分析之前,明确分析目标至关重要。分析目标决定了数据的收集方式、分析方法以及最终的表格展示形式。明确分析目标可以帮助你聚焦在重要的数据上,并有效地排除干扰信息。例如,若目标是分析用户行为,那么你需要收集用户点击、停留时间、页面跳转等相关数据。
二、选择合适的数据分析工具
选择合适的数据分析工具是整个数据分析过程的核心。不同的数据分析工具有不同的功能和适用场景。FineBI作为帆软旗下的一款专业数据分析工具,具备强大的数据处理和分析能力,适合多种数据分析需求。FineBI不仅支持多种数据源的接入,还提供丰富的数据可视化组件,帮助用户轻松创建专业的分析表格。FineBI官网: https://s.fanruan.com/f459r;。
三、收集并整理数据
数据收集是数据分析的基础。根据分析目标,从不同的数据源收集所需的数据。数据源可以是数据库、日志文件、第三方API等。收集到的数据往往是杂乱无章的,需要进行整理和清洗。数据整理包括去重、补全缺失值、统一数据格式等步骤。高质量的数据是成功分析的前提。
四、设计表格结构
设计表格结构是数据分析的重要一步。表格结构决定了数据的展示方式和分析的效果。设计表格结构时,需要考虑数据的层次性、关联性和可读性。例如,可以将数据按照时间、类别等维度进行分类展示,以便更清晰地呈现数据的变化趋势和分布情况。FineBI支持自定义表格结构,用户可以根据需要灵活调整。
五、应用数据可视化技术
数据可视化技术可以帮助用户更直观地理解数据。FineBI提供了丰富的数据可视化组件,如柱状图、折线图、饼图等,用户可以根据数据特性选择合适的可视化方式。通过数据可视化,可以将复杂的数据转化为易于理解的信息,提高数据分析的效率和效果。
六、生成并分享分析报告
完成数据分析表格后,可以生成分析报告。FineBI支持多种报告导出格式,如PDF、Excel等,用户可以根据需要选择合适的格式。生成的分析报告可以通过邮件、共享链接等方式分享给团队成员或相关人员,便于沟通和决策。
七、持续监控和优化
数据分析是一个持续的过程。通过持续监控和优化,可以及时发现问题并进行调整。FineBI支持实时数据更新和分析,用户可以随时查看最新数据并进行分析。通过持续监控和优化,可以不断提高数据分析的准确性和效率。
八、实例分析
为了更好地理解数据分析表格的制作过程,下面以一个实例进行说明。假设我们要分析一个电商网站的用户行为数据。首先,明确分析目标:了解用户在网站上的行为习惯,以便优化网站布局和内容。接着,选择FineBI作为数据分析工具。然后,从网站日志中收集用户点击、停留时间、页面跳转等数据,并对数据进行整理和清洗。设计表格结构时,可以按时间、页面类别等维度分类展示数据。应用数据可视化技术,如使用柱状图展示不同页面的点击量、折线图展示用户在网站上的停留时间变化趋势等。生成分析报告后,通过邮件分享给团队成员。持续监控用户行为数据,并根据分析结果优化网站布局和内容。
九、总结
制作网页数据分析表格需要明确分析目标、选择合适的数据分析工具、收集并整理数据、设计表格结构、应用数据可视化技术。FineBI作为一款专业的数据分析工具,具备强大的数据处理和分析能力,能够帮助用户轻松创建专业的分析表格。通过实例分析,可以更好地理解数据分析表格的制作过程。持续监控和优化是提高数据分析准确性和效率的关键。FineBI官网: https://s.fanruan.com/f459r;。
制作网页数据分析表格不仅可以帮助你更好地理解数据,还能为决策提供有力支持。通过科学的方法和专业的工具,可以大大提高数据分析的效率和效果。希望本文能够为你提供有价值的指导,助你在数据分析的道路上取得成功。
相关问答FAQs:
如何制作网页数据分析表格?
在当今数据驱动的时代,网页数据分析表格成为了分析和展示数据的重要工具。无论是个人项目还是企业需求,掌握制作网页数据分析表格的技能都显得尤为重要。以下是一些常见问题及其详细解答,帮助你更好地理解如何制作网页数据分析表格。
1. 什么是网页数据分析表格?
网页数据分析表格是用于在网页上展示和分析数据的表格形式。这种表格通常由HTML、CSS和JavaScript等技术构建,能够动态展示数据,使用户可以更直观地理解信息。网页数据分析表格不仅可以展示静态数据,还可以通过各种交互功能(如排序、筛选和分页)来增强用户体验。
主要特点:
- 动态交互性:用户可以对数据进行排序、筛选和搜索。
- 美观性:通过CSS可以使表格更具吸引力。
- 响应式设计:适应不同设备的屏幕尺寸。
2. 如何创建网页数据分析表格?
创建网页数据分析表格的过程涉及多个步骤,从数据准备到最终的网页展示。以下是具体步骤:
数据准备
收集和整理待分析的数据,确保数据的准确性和完整性。可以使用Excel、CSV等格式来保存数据。
使用HTML构建表格
使用HTML标签构建基础的表格结构。HTML中的<table>、<tr>、<th>和<td>标签分别用于定义表格、行、表头和单元格。
<table>
<tr>
<th>名称</th>
<th>数量</th>
<th>价格</th>
</tr>
<tr>
<td>苹果</td>
<td>10</td>
<td>5</td>
</tr>
<tr>
<td>香蕉</td>
<td>20</td>
<td>3</td>
</tr>
</table>
添加CSS样式
使用CSS来美化表格,设置边框、背景色、字体等。可以使表格更加易读和美观。
table {
width: 100%;
border-collapse: collapse;
}
th, td {
border: 1px solid #dddddd;
text-align: left;
padding: 8px;
}
th {
background-color: #f2f2f2;
}
引入JavaScript增强功能
使用JavaScript或jQuery来为表格添加交互功能,例如排序和筛选。
// 示例:简单的排序功能
function sortTable(n) {
let table, rows, switching, i, x, y, shouldSwitch;
table = document.getElementById("myTable");
switching = true;
while (switching) {
switching = false;
rows = table.rows;
for (i = 1; i < (rows.length - 1); i++) {
shouldSwitch = false;
x = rows[i].getElementsByTagName("TD")[n];
y = rows[i + 1].getElementsByTagName("TD")[n];
if (x.innerHTML > y.innerHTML) {
shouldSwitch = true;
break;
}
}
if (shouldSwitch) {
rows[i].parentNode.insertBefore(rows[i + 1], rows[i]);
switching = true;
}
}
}
3. 使用什么工具可以帮助制作网页数据分析表格?
在制作网页数据分析表格时,有许多工具可以提高效率和效果。以下是一些推荐的工具和库:
Excel或Google Sheets
可以使用Excel或Google Sheets进行数据整理和预处理。这些工具提供了强大的数据处理和分析功能,方便用户快速处理数据。
DataTables
DataTables是一个非常流行的jQuery插件,能够轻松为HTML表格添加排序、搜索和分页功能。只需少量代码,就能实现复杂的表格功能。
$(document).ready(function() {
$('#example').DataTable();
});
Chart.js
对于需要将数据可视化的场合,可以使用Chart.js等库,这些工具能够将数据转化为图表,帮助用户更直观地理解数据。
4. 如何优化网页数据分析表格的性能?
在处理大量数据时,性能问题可能成为瓶颈。以下是一些优化建议:
数据分页
将数据分成多个页面展示,减少一次性加载的数据量,提高加载速度。
懒加载
采用懒加载技术,只有在用户滚动到特定位置时才加载更多数据,减少初始加载时间。
精简DOM操作
尽量减少对DOM的操作次数,可以通过批量更新的方式来提高性能。
5. 如何在网页数据分析表格中实现数据导入和导出功能?
数据导入和导出功能可以大大提高表格的实用性。以下是实现的方法:
数据导入
可以使用HTML文件输入元素,允许用户上传CSV文件。然后通过JavaScript读取文件内容,将数据解析后填充到表格中。
<input type="file" id="fileInput">
document.getElementById('fileInput').addEventListener('change', function(event) {
const file = event.target.files[0];
const reader = new FileReader();
reader.onload = function(e) {
const data = e.target.result;
// 解析CSV数据并填充表格
};
reader.readAsText(file);
});
数据导出
可以使用JavaScript将表格数据导出为CSV文件。通过创建一个链接并动态设置其href属性,可以实现数据导出。
function exportTableToCSV(filename) {
const csv = [];
const rows = document.querySelectorAll("table tr");
for (let i = 0; i < rows.length; i++) {
const row = [], cols = rows[i].querySelectorAll("td, th");
for (let j = 0; j < cols.length; j++) {
row.push(cols[j].innerText);
}
csv.push(row.join(","));
}
const csvFile = new Blob([csv.join("\n")], { type: 'text/csv' });
const downloadLink = document.createElement("a");
downloadLink.download = filename;
downloadLink.href = window.URL.createObjectURL(csvFile);
downloadLink.style.display = "none";
document.body.appendChild(downloadLink);
downloadLink.click();
}
6. 如何确保网页数据分析表格的兼容性和可访问性?
确保网页数据分析表格在不同浏览器和设备上良好运行,以及为所有用户提供良好的访问体验至关重要。
兼容性
使用HTML5和CSS3的标准特性,避免使用过时或不兼容的技术。测试表格在主流浏览器(如Chrome、Firefox、Safari等)中的表现。
可访问性
遵循Web内容无障碍指南(WCAG),为表格添加适当的ARIA标签,使屏幕阅读器能够识别和读取表格内容。此外,确保表格的结构清晰,使用合适的标题和描述。
7. 如何处理动态数据更新?
在许多场景中,数据需要实时更新。可以通过AJAX请求从服务器获取最新数据,并更新表格。
function updateTable() {
fetch('api/data-endpoint')
.then(response => response.json())
.then(data => {
// 更新表格数据
});
}
// 定时更新
setInterval(updateTable, 60000); // 每60秒更新一次
8. 如何分析和解读网页数据分析表格中的数据?
数据的分析和解读是数据驱动决策的重要环节。以下是一些基本的分析技巧:
识别趋势
观察数据的变化趋势,例如销售额的上升或下降,帮助企业做出战略决策。
进行比较
对比不同数据集或时间段的数据,找出表现优异或需要改进的领域。
使用统计方法
应用基本的统计学知识,如平均值、标准差等,深入理解数据的分布和特征。
9. 如何在网页数据分析表格中实现用户权限管理?
在某些情况下,不同用户可能需要访问不同的数据。可以通过用户身份验证和权限管理来控制数据的访问。
用户身份验证
通过登录系统验证用户身份,确保只有经过授权的用户才能访问特定数据。
权限控制
根据用户角色设置不同的权限,限制某些用户对敏感数据的访问。
10. 有哪些最佳实践可以遵循以提高网页数据分析表格的用户体验?
提升用户体验是制作网页数据分析表格的重要目标。以下是一些最佳实践:
简洁明了的设计
保持表格设计的简洁,避免不必要的复杂性,让用户能够快速获取信息。
提供帮助信息
在表格旁边提供工具提示或帮助信息,帮助用户理解如何使用表格的各种功能。
及时反馈
在用户进行操作时,例如排序或筛选,及时提供反馈,增强互动体验。
通过遵循以上建议,制作网页数据分析表格不仅能够满足基本功能需求,还能为用户提供愉悦的体验。在数据驱动的背景下,掌握这一技能将为你的工作增添更多价值。
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。具体产品功能请以帆软官方帮助文档为准,或联系您的对接销售进行咨询。如有其他问题,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。



